6 months agoSupposed to be the only proper Georgian restaurant in Bangkok. I have never experienced any Georgian food before and this place is great! A bit crowded on Friday night, luckily we booked way in advance so no issue here. The place is a bit hidden from the street, even though it is quite close to main Sukhumvit road. Most of the customers were expats, we were among the few Thais. The food were fresh, finely cooked and tasted great. We ordered quite a variety of them and we enjoyed all plates. Highly recommend the 3-dips set, Eggplant roll, Eggplant salad, Dumpling (we loved the cheese one), the Kebab thing (those tomatoes were so good!) and Acharuli. The amber Georgian wine is good too. The Napolean’s cake is on the sweet side but still good. We were there from 18:00-22:45 and were having such a great time.
